Malaysia's restaurant industry is embracing QR code ordering at rapid speed. From Kuala Lumpur cafes to Penang food courts, QR ordering helps restaurants reduce labor costs, minimize order errors, and handle multiple delivery platforms from a single interface.

Why Malaysian Restaurants Are Switching to QR Ordering

The food delivery boom in Malaysia has created new challenges for restaurant operators. Managing orders from GrabFood, Foodpanda, and Gojek on separate devices leads to:

  • Order confusion — Staff mixing up orders from different apps
  • Slow service — Running between tablets during peak hours
  • Rising labor costs — Need for more staff to manage multiple platforms
  • Inventory gaps — No real-time stock updates across platforms

QR code ordering combined with a tablet POS solves these problems by aggregating all orders — dine-in and delivery — onto one screen.

How QR Ordering Works in Malaysia

For Dine-In Customers

Customers scan a QR code at their table using their phone. They browse the menu, customize items, and place their order directly to the kitchen. No waitstaff needed for taking orders.

For Delivery Orders

GrabFood, Foodpanda, and Gojek orders appear automatically on the same system. Kitchen staff see all orders on a Kitchen Display System (KDS) screen, sorted by platform and time.

Payment Methods for Malaysian Restaurants

QR ordering works best when paired with QR payments. Malaysian customers expect:

  • Touch n Go — Most popular e-wallet
  • Boost — Second-largest e-wallet
  • DuitNow QR — Bank-backed QR standard
  • Cash — Still important for hawkers and budget restaurants
